"Trout at Ten Thousand Feet is an original and very personal collection of stories by John Bailey about his love of fish and the pleasures of fishing. .His extraordinary adventures (which tell of espionage, death threats and even a plane crash) have taken him to some of the most remote and inhospitable places. Covering all shapes and sizes of fish from anchovy to zander, this exciting, often humorous book, brilliantly captures the magical mysterious and addictive nature of fishing, as well as introducing a motley collection of characters from around the globe." Chapters include: John the fish; Fishing the flowing dream; Arctic lightning; Song of the sturgeon; Mongolian odyssey; Trout at ten thousand feet; The turning of the tide; Icon fish; The never ending dream.
